Kiefer: meaning, origin, and trend context

Kiefer evokes calm and a steady, grounded presence.

Meaning: Often linked to nature and serenity, Kiefer suggests a peaceful, reliable character.. Origin: Germanic Pronunciation: KEE-fer.

Kiefer is rooted in Germanic origins and is commonly associated with calmness and tranquility. The name’s strong, simple sound makes it versatile for various middle names and families seeking a serene, enduring choice. In 2026, Kiefer remains a solid option for parents who want a name that conveys quiet strength.
